Principal Sales Operations Analyst

MRI Software
Remote

About The Position

The Principal Sales Operations Analyst serves as a functional expert and is responsible for driving operational excellence across CRM governance, forecasting support, pipeline management, reporting, sales process execution, and cross-functional operational coordination. The Principal Sales Operations Analyst provides advanced operational leadership without direct people management responsibilities, serving as a mentor, subject matter expert, escalation point, and operational lead across the Sales Operations function. This role partners closely with Sales Leadership, Revenue Operations, Finance, Order Management, and Global Delivery Center (GDC) teams to improve sales execution, operational consistency, data integrity, and sales velocity. This position requires deep Salesforce expertise, strong operational judgment, and the ability to independently lead complex operational initiatives within a high-growth SaaS sales environment.

Requirements

  • 10+ years’ experience in Sales Operations, Revenue Operations, or related analytical role
  • Deep expertise in Salesforce CRM administration, governance, and reporting
  • Strong experience supporting SaaS or recurring revenue sales organizations
  • Advanced analytical, operational, and problem-solving capabilities
  • Experience supporting forecasting processes and pipeline management activities
  • Strong stakeholder management and cross-functional collaboration skills
  • Demonstrated success driving operational improvements and process standardization
  • Experience mentoring operational team members and leading through influence

Responsibilities

  • Oversee Salesforce operational activities including opportunity, account, contact, and territory management updates
  • Ensure CRM data quality, governance standards, and process adherence across the sales organization
  • Partner cross-functionally to support organizational changes, personnel updates, territory realignments, and account ownership changes within Salesforce
  • Serve as the primary North America Salesforce operational expert and advisor for sales process execution and CRM governance
  • Provide operational input and business requirements support for global Salesforce-related initiatives in partnership with RevApps and RevOps teams
  • Support forecasting processes, pipeline inspection cadence, and sales operational reviews
  • Assist Sales leadership with pipeline health analysis, reporting accuracy, and operational insights
  • Create and deliver ad hoc reporting, dashboards, and operational analysis for North America Sales teams and leadership
  • Identify operational trends, risks, and process inefficiencies and provide actionable recommendations
  • Support executive reporting and operational performance tracking activities
  • Partner with Sales Leadership, Revenue Operations, Finance, Order Management, and other operational teams to improve sales execution and operational alignment
  • Drive process standardization and operational scalability across the quote-to-close lifecycle
  • Support operational initiatives focused on improving sales velocity, forecasting accuracy, CRM adoption, and reporting consistency
  • Assist with implementation and refinement of operational processes, controls, and best practices
  • Lead or support ad hoc operational projects and strategic initiatives as assigned
